Russia has successfully fired an intercontinental ballistic missile, Moscow’s Defence Ministry has said. The RS-12M Topol successfully hit its target at a range in Kazakhstan as tensions with North Korea’s crackpot despot Kim Jong-un threaten to boil over. The warhead test took place at the Kapustin Yar range in Russia’s southern Astrakhan Region. It could be a warning shot to Kim Jong-un as the test

comes just a day after his henchmen accused President Donald Trump of declaring war on North Korea. Officials said the test data would be used to develop prospective means of breaching “enemy” missile defenses for use in Russian ballistic missiles. “The goal of the launch was to test advanced ballistic missile warheads.” According to the ministry, data on the Topol launch will be used to develop advanced anti-missile defense penetration aids.
